Starmount lost against North Wilkes back in September and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Thursday. The Rams lost 3-0 to the Vikings.
Starmount's defeat was their third straight on the road, which dropped their record down to 11-9. As for North Wilkes, they are on a roll lately: they've won 13 of their last 14 cont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 16-4 record this season.
We've got plenty of inter-conference action coming up soon. Starmount is set to challenge their familiar foe Wilkes Central at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Meanwhile, North Wilkes will take on rival Alleghany at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
